Output 5f85b980400a804cfb870eef98c2a0a15593a47dc753160d31537edc09e07346:1

value
1001671838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cc40f8e566c2a22c60f2799dad9b2b602d7ed3b OP_EQUAL
address
3D4iasW82T1Ri1ifSwYXXJyz1hqsUFJqVa
transaction
5f85b980400a804cfb870eef98c2a0a15593a47dc753160d31537edc09e07346
confirmations
385711
spent
true